1975 Logan’s Run Studio Press Tour

Now here’s something you don’t see everyday. This short clip is a fascinating look behind the scenes at the making of Logan’s Run movie, focusing on a 1975 MGM studio press publicity tour. This movie is a classic and definitely a product of it’s era. One of my all-time favorites for sure.

This clip briefly shows the director, the producer and costume designer and more. Some of the movies costumes are also being shown off, though the Sandman uniform would be different in the film. The strangest part is near the end, when the guy modeling the Sandman uniform turns out to be David Hasselhoff. That has to be him.

Return Of The Jedi: Location Special Effects

If you like his work, you can head on over to Patreon and support Jamie Benning. He’s a documentary film maker and this short clip is an interview with Kevin Pike, who worked not only on Back to the Future, but also on Return of the Jedi.

It’s a fascinating clip and a great look behind the scenes, so it is certainly worth supporting Jamie so he can continue making documentaries. In this clip, Kevin Pike talks about his work on the Location Special Effects on Return of the Jedi.

Alien Motorcycle Concept Looks Fast, Scary

This Alien-inspired motorcycle is beautifully designed, although I doubt very much that any future movies would call for the use of such a cool Alien bike. It was created by industrial designer Tamás Jakus. It is a customized black-on-black Yamaha SR with design cues inspired by H.R. Giger’s aliens.

I love all of the detail, which isn’t overdone. Everything is just perfect. The fuel tank is shaped like a Xenomorphs head and has a Weyland Corporation logo. Too bad it doesn’t exist in real life. Ripley could make good use of this sweet ride.
